Hi,
I wanted to try out gfs2 instead of ocfs2 because of the acl's that it
supports, but I do not get it running. I am on openSUSE 10.2, x86_64.
my kernel is
Linux srv4 2.6.20.15-default #1 SMP Fri Jul 13 12:44:51 CEST 2007 x86_64
x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
I have openais rpm's created from source rpm's:
openais-devel-0.80.1-6
openais-0.80.1-6
and I use cluster-2.00.00, just compiled from source. My *.lcrso files are
in /usr/lib64/lcrso/ and /usr/libexec/lcrso/. The LD_LIBRARY_PATH and the
PATH variable have both pathes included.
when I start /etc/init.d/cman then I see the following:
/etc/init.d/cman start
Starting cluster:
Loading modules... done
Mounting configfs... done
Starting ccsd... done
Starting cman... failed
/usr/sbin/cman_tool: aisexec daemon didn't start
/etc/init.d/cman: line 413: failure: command not found
and this is /var/log/messages:
Jul 16 15:10:00 srv4 ccsd[23855]: Starting ccsd 2.00.00:
Jul 16 15:10:00 srv4 ccsd[23855]: Built: Jul 13 2007 13:24:27
Jul 16 15:10:00 srv4 ccsd[23855]: Copyright (C) Red Hat, Inc. 2004 All
rights reserved.
Jul 16 15:10:00 srv4 ccsd[23855]: cluster.conf (cluster name = correo,
version = 1) found.
Jul 16 15:10:01 srv4 aisexec: [MAIN ] AIS Executive Service RELEASE 'subrev
1204 version 0.80.1'
Jul 16 15:10:01 srv4 aisexec: [MAIN ] Copyright (C) 2002-2006 MontaVista
Software, Inc and contributors.
Jul 16 15:10:01 srv4 aisexec: [MAIN ] Copyright (C) 2006 Red Hat, Inc.
Jul 16 15:10:01 srv4 aisexec: [MAIN ] AIS Executive couldn't open
configuration object database component.
Jul 16 15:10:01 srv4 aisexec: [MAIN ] AIS Executive exiting (-13).
When I run cman_tool -w join manually, the same happens, when I run it
within strace, I see it trying sometimes to connect to the
socket /var/run/cman_admin, and then it fails, because the socket is not
there.
I can start aisexec, but it does not create sockets /var/run/cman_client
and /var/run/cman_admin.
